升级到 SQL Server 2000 后,在 SQL 事件查看器中无法捕获带有参数的 Transact-SQL 语句,只能看到参数形式(如 @p1)。如何获取参数的实际值?
SQL Server Profiler参数捕获
相关推荐
使用C#实现SQL Server Profiler
经过长时间的研究,成功用C#编写了一个能够跟踪SQL Server 2008数据库客户端执行SQL操作的工具。该工具能够捕获所有客户端对数据库的操作,并将其记录为日志,实现数据库内容的有效备份。在实现过程中,主要利用了SQL Server 2008 SDK中的两个关键动态库:Microsoft.SqlServerConnectionInfoExtended.dll和Microsoft.SqlServer.ConnectionInfo.dll。目前程序中存储日志的部分尚未完善,同时还需要解决涉及多线程操作DataGridView时程序无响应的问题。
SQLServer
2
2024-07-16
SQL Server 2005 Profiler 与 事件跟踪器
SQL Server 2005 家族拥有功能全面的事件跟踪器,但在开发过程中存在一些限制。例如,标准版 SQL Server 不包含事件探查器分析工具。SQL Server Express 版 Profiler 提供了标准探查器的绝大部分功能,是通过 Web 连接 Windows CE 数据库的必备工具。
SQLServer
4
2024-05-15
SQL Server 2005/2008 Express Profiler(事件追踪器)
SQL Server 2005/2008 Express Profiler(事件追踪器)数据库插件与SQL Server 2005/2008 Express完全兼容。
SQLServer
0
2024-08-15
SQL Server 2008 Profiler详细配置与应用解析
SQL Server 2008 Profiler是一款图形化工具,专为监控SQL Server实时活动而设计。它能捕获并分析SQL Server的跟踪数据,包括查询处理、登录事件和错误消息等。使用Profiler有助于调试应用程序、优化性能以及监控服务器行为。安装Profiler可以通过SQL Server安装向导的“功能”选项完成,确保选择“性能工具- SQL Server Profiler”。启动Profiler后,可以通过选择服务器实例和设置跟踪参数来创建新的跟踪。选择监控的事件类别和事件过滤条件后,即可运行跟踪并查看结果,也可以将结果导出供后续分析使用。
SQLServer
0
2024-08-25
SQL Profiler的使用指南
SQL Profiler使用方法详解,监控SQL执行效率的技巧。
SQLServer
0
2024-08-05
MySQL线上SQL捕获及分析
MySQL线上SQL捕获
SQL分析
MySQL
3
2024-05-26
MySQL线上SQL捕获及分析指南
Pt-query-digest输出文件概述:当前日期分析的时间,机器名为主机名,分析了慢日志名。总共捕获了23.33k条SQL,归类为41种不同类型,平均每秒262.10条慢日志,最高并发度为100.40x。慢日志的时间范围为2014-10-23 16:22:33至16:24:02。主要属性包括执行时间8935秒,锁定时间6687秒,发送的行数18.90k,检查的行数1.04M,影响的行数10.08k,发送的字节数4.75M,查询大小2.37M。
MySQL
0
2024-08-23
参数说明-SQL Server数据库管理
database_name:新数据库的名称
ON:显示存储数据库数据部分(数据文件)的磁盘文件
n:占位符,用于指定多个新数据库文件
LOG ON:显示存储数据库日志(日志文件)的磁盘文件
SQLServer
4
2024-05-16
SQL Server存储过程编写与参数传递实战
在 SQL Server 中,编写存储过程可以有效管理数据库中的数据操作。以下是如何创建一个用于 数据入库 的存储过程,并如何传递 参数 的示例。
存储过程编写
创建一个存储过程,用于将数据插入到表中。示例如下:
CREATE PROCEDURE InsertData
@Name NVARCHAR(100),
@Age INT
AS
BEGIN
INSERT INTO Users (Name, Age)
VALUES (@Name, @Age);
END;
调用存储过程
使用以下 SQL 语句来调用存储过程并传递参数:
EXEC InsertData @Name = 'John Doe', @Age = 30;
参数传递
在存储过程中,使用 @ 符号来声明参数。
调用时,根据存储过程的定义传递相应的参数值。
总结
通过存储过程,可以实现高效、可复用的数据操作,同时利用参数传递实现灵活的功能调用。
SQLServer
0
2024-11-05